Elena Tonti is a scholar working on Immunology, Oncology and Physi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Elena Tonti has authored 14 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Immunology, 5 papers in Oncology and 4 papers in Physiology. Recurrent topics in Elena Tonti’s work include Immune Cell Function and Interaction (7 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(6 papers) and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(4 papers). Elena Tonti is often cited by papers focused on Immune Cell Function and Interaction (7 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(6 papers) and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(4 papers). Elena Tonti collaborates with scholars based in Italy, United States and Canada. Elena Tonti's co-authors include Ulrich H. von Andrian, Matteo Iannacone, Paolo Dellabona, Giulia Casorati, E. Ashley Moseman, Lidia Bosurgi, Luca G. Guidotti, Sergio Abrignani, Tobias Junt and Sarah E. Henrickson and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Blood.
